What is Easy Holdings' Growth Strategy?

Easy Holdings, a South Korean company founded in 1988, has grown into a significant player in the biological resource industry, focusing on farming and livestock food and feed additives. Its strategic expansion and commitment to innovation have positioned it for continued success in the global market.

Key Expansion Initiatives

Easy Holdings' expansion initiatives are multifaceted, focusing on both organic growth and strategic consolidation. The company's approach to growth is detailed in the Marketing Strategy of Easy Holdings.

  • In February 2024, Easy Bio USA acquired Devenish Nutrition LLC, enhancing the feed additive and premix business in North America.
  • This acquisition leverages Devenish Nutrition's infrastructure, including five production plants and six research facilities across the United States and Mexico.
  • Easy Holdings previously acquired a 27.8% stake in EASY BIO, Inc. for approximately KRW 46.4 billion.
  • A bid was made in March 2021 to acquire an additional 77.23% stake in EASY BIO, Inc. for approximately KRW 130 billion.
  • The company is also focused on new product launches within its core feed and meat processing segments.
  • Sustainability is a key long-term strategic focus across five main areas.

Icon Shareholder Value Initiatives

In March 2024, Easy Holdings initiated an equity buyback program valued at KRW 2,000 million, scheduled to continue until January 31, 2025. This move is designed to stabilize its stock price and boost shareholder returns.

Icon Diversified Revenue Streams

The company generates revenue through four primary segments: Feed Business, Meat Processing Business, Poultry Business, and Other Business. This diversification helps to mitigate risks and provides multiple avenues for growth.

What Risks Could Slow Easy Holdings’s Growth?

Easy Holdings navigates a competitive landscape within the biological resource sector, facing challenges from both domestic and international entities. Its strategic expansion, including the acquisition of Devenish Nutrition LLC, aims to bolster its market position, particularly in North America, but intensified competition can lead to pricing pressures and difficulties in gaining market share.

Icon

Market Competition

The biological resource industry, encompassing feed, livestock, and processed meat, is highly competitive. This intense rivalry can exert downward pressure on pricing and complicate efforts to expand market share.

Icon

Regulatory Environment

Evolving regulations in animal welfare, food safety, and environmental impact within the agro-livestock sector may require significant operational adjustments and capital investments.

Icon

Supply Chain Vulnerabilities

Dependence on raw materials for feed production and complex global logistics expose the company to disruptions from geopolitical events, natural disasters, or shifts in trade policies.

Icon

Technological Adaptation

Failure to quickly adopt advancements in biotechnology, feed formulations, or processing techniques could lead to a competitive disadvantage, as highlighted by the transformative potential of AI and automation noted in the 'Future of Jobs Report 2025'.
